Shrivenham Undulator - Morning Ride

 57 km  451 m  02:15  x4
Ride Category
Given the weather immediately before the start time, initially I wasn't thrilled to find three other, somewhat more keen, Corallians waiting at the statue. However, the rain stopped at 10am on the dot and it wasn't long before waterproofs were being removed. After a playful duel with the DHL van that lasted from Wantage to Lambourn (multiple overtakes between delivery drops) we got over to the ever popular Bloomfields Cafe in Shrivenham in the dry. Louis, fresh from a hippy forest retreat, was very Zen about lingering over our coffee and cake, although not quite Zen enough to avoid pronouncing the coffee itself to be a bit "meh".

Back on the road, the rain came down proper and we got very wet as we surfed along in front of a decent tail wind. Nobody fancied sitting in wet tights and rain filled boots so no pub today.

As ever - once you get out there doing it, it wasn't so bad after all.
